The Role

This is a hands-on coordination role where you ll take ownership of all Mechanical & Electrical elements across live projects.

You ll act as the critical link between design, site teams, subcontractors, and clients, ensuring M&E works are fully coordinated, buildable, and delivered on programme.

From early design through to commissioning and handover, you ll be central to ensuring projects run smoothly and efficiently.

Key Responsibilities

  • Coordinate Mechanical & Electrical works across major civil engineering projects

  • Manage the full lifecycle: design, procurement, installation, commissioning

  • Work closely with design teams and subcontractors to ensure practical, buildable solutions

  • Identify risks early and implement mitigation strategies

  • Liaise with clients, consultants, and internal stakeholders

  • Ensure all works meet strict Health & Safety and environmental standards

  • Oversee quality, including Inspection & Test Plans

  • Support procurement of M&E packages and subcontractors

  • Assist with commissioning, documentation, and project handover

  • Contribute to planning, sequencing, and construction methodology

  • Drive innovation and continuous improvement across projects
